Searched refs:precomp (Results 1 – 4 of 4) sorted by relevance
| /f-stack/dpdk/lib/librte_net/ |
| H A D | net_crc_sse.c | 47 __m128i precomp, in crcr32_folding_round() argument 50 __m128i tmp0 = _mm_clmulepi64_si128(fold, precomp, 0x01); in crcr32_folding_round() 51 __m128i tmp1 = _mm_clmulepi64_si128(fold, precomp, 0x10); in crcr32_folding_round() 69 crcr32_reduce_128_to_64(__m128i data128, __m128i precomp) in crcr32_reduce_128_to_64() argument 74 tmp0 = _mm_clmulepi64_si128(data128, precomp, 0x00); in crcr32_reduce_128_to_64() 80 tmp1 = _mm_clmulepi64_si128(tmp2, precomp, 0x10); in crcr32_reduce_128_to_64() 98 crcr32_reduce_64_to_32(__m128i data64, __m128i precomp) in crcr32_reduce_64_to_32() argument 111 tmp1 = _mm_clmulepi64_si128(tmp0, precomp, 0x00); in crcr32_reduce_64_to_32() 115 tmp2 = _mm_clmulepi64_si128(tmp1, precomp, 0x10); in crcr32_reduce_64_to_32()
|
| H A D | net_crc_neon.c | 43 crcr32_folding_round(uint64x2_t data_block, uint64x2_t precomp, in crcr32_folding_round() argument 48 vgetq_lane_p64(vreinterpretq_p64_u64(precomp), 0))); in crcr32_folding_round() 52 vgetq_lane_p64(vreinterpretq_p64_u64(precomp), 1))); in crcr32_folding_round() 67 uint64x2_t precomp) in crcr32_reduce_128_to_64() argument 74 vgetq_lane_p64(vreinterpretq_p64_u64(precomp), 0))); in crcr32_reduce_128_to_64() 82 vgetq_lane_p64(vreinterpretq_p64_u64(precomp), 1))); in crcr32_reduce_128_to_64() 97 uint64x2_t precomp) in crcr32_reduce_64_to_32() argument 111 vgetq_lane_p64(vreinterpretq_p64_u64(precomp), 0))); in crcr32_reduce_64_to_32() 117 vgetq_lane_p64(vreinterpretq_p64_u64(precomp), 1))); in crcr32_reduce_64_to_32()
|
| H A D | net_crc_avx512.c | 52 crcr32_folding_round(__m512i data_block, __m512i precomp, __m512i fold) in crcr32_folding_round() argument 56 tmp0 = _mm512_clmulepi64_epi128(fold, precomp, 0x01); in crcr32_folding_round() 57 tmp1 = _mm512_clmulepi64_epi128(fold, precomp, 0x10); in crcr32_folding_round()
|
| /f-stack/freebsd/contrib/libsodium/src/libsodium/crypto_core/ed25519/ref10/ |
| H A D | ed25519_ref10.c | 553 ge25519_select(ge25519_precomp *t, const ge25519_precomp precomp[8], const signed char b) in ge25519_select() 560 ge25519_cmov(t, &precomp[0], equal(babs, 1)); in ge25519_select() 561 ge25519_cmov(t, &precomp[1], equal(babs, 2)); in ge25519_select() 562 ge25519_cmov(t, &precomp[2], equal(babs, 3)); in ge25519_select() 563 ge25519_cmov(t, &precomp[3], equal(babs, 4)); in ge25519_select() 564 ge25519_cmov(t, &precomp[4], equal(babs, 5)); in ge25519_select() 565 ge25519_cmov(t, &precomp[5], equal(babs, 6)); in ge25519_select() 566 ge25519_cmov(t, &precomp[6], equal(babs, 7)); in ge25519_select() 567 ge25519_cmov(t, &precomp[7], equal(babs, 8)); in ge25519_select()
|